    For the adverage person making changes to their bike. There are all kinds of tuners for your bike. Some are limited model tuners. When you make major changes such as cams they don't go that far.
    Which do you think is the best tuner to have.

    So there are Power Commander V with Auto Tune. Thundermax with Auto Tune and I hear about a new Power Vision made by Power Commander

    YouTube - Dynojet Power Vision

    The Sert which has to be dynoed by a dyno person.
    And the TTS masterTune. How many adverage people can do much with this program.

    Which would be the best tuner to use. And how would a adverage person learn how to control their timing.
    Know the auto tune feature of A/T models would tune the AFR's.
